Omair Rana (born January 31, 1978) is a Pakistani actor and theatre director. He had his early education in University College Lahore (UCL), which was instrumental in polishing his acting skills. In the course of his career development, he also undertook a number of internships including one with the Lahore Chamber of Commerce & Industry.
Career
He is a renowned theater actor in the region who has made a significant contribution in the field of teaching Dramatics Art at a number of institutions, including introducing IGCSE Drama to Pakistan in 2009. He also directs plays in educational institutes, notably One Flew Over The Cuckoo's Nest (2014) and Life of Galileo (2013) at Lahore Grammar School Johar Town campus. He runs his theatre company by the name of Real Entertainment Productions (REP) that was founded in 2000 and has done over 50 plays ever since.
As a screen actor he has also worked in numerous TV productions and in the films Chambaili and Tamanna.
Rana (Sanskrit: राणा) is a historical title of Rajput origin, denoting the rank of an absolute Monarch.
Today, it is being used as a hereditary name in South Asia.
Rani is the title for the wife of a Rana or a female monarch. Rani also applies to the wife of a Raja. Compound titles include Rana Sahib, Ranaji, Rana Bahadur, and Maharana.
Royal title in India
Rana was formerly used as a title of martial sovereignty by Rajput kings in India.
Rana title in Pakistan
Members of different Rajput clans use Rana as a hereditary title in Pakistan and their majority is Muslim. However Hindu Rajputs with this title also exist in Sindh.Umerkot was a state with a Hindu Rajput ruler using the title Rana in Sindh (presen-day Pakistan). In the 16th century Rana Prasad, the then Rana of Umerkot, gave refuge to Mughal prince Humayun and his wife Hamida Banu Begum, who fled from military defeat at the hands of Sher Shah Suri. Their son Akbar was born in the fort of the Rana of Umerkot.
The Kingdom of Nepal (Nepali:नेपाल अधिराज्य), also known as the Kingdom of Gorkha (Nepali:गोर्खा अधिराज्य), was a kingdom formed in 1768 by the unification of Nepal. Founded by King Prithvi Narayan Shah, a Gorkhali monarch, it existed for 240 years until the abolition of the Nepalese monarchy in 2008. During this period, Nepal was formally under the rule of the Shah dynasty, which exercised varying degrees of power during the kingdom's existence.
Despite a humiliating defeat to China after a failed invasion of Tibet in the 1790s, which led to Nepal becoming a tributary state of the Chinese Empire, Nepal successfully consolidated its territories in the ensuing years. During the early-nineteenth century, however, the expansion of the East India Company's rule in India led to the Anglo-Nepalese War (1814–1816), which resulted in Nepal's defeat. Under the Sugauli Treaty, the kingdom retained its independence, but became a de factoprotectorate of Britain in exchange for territorial concessions equating to a third of the territory then under Nepalese rule, sometimes known as "Greater Nepal". Political instability following the war resulted in the ascendancy of the Rana dynasty, which made the office of Prime Ministers of Nepal hereditary in their family for the next century, from 1843 to 1951. Beginning with Jung Bahadur, the first Rana ruler, the Rana dynasty reduced the Shah monarch to a figurehead role. Rana rule was marked by tyranny, debauchery, economic exploitation and religious persecution.

After the release of Enthiran (2010), Rajinikanth approached K. S. Ravikumar to help complete an animation feature that Soundarya Rajinikanth had begun in 2007. The project, titled Sultan: The Warrior, had run into problems with its production and Rajinikanth hoped that they could salvage the project by adding a historical back plot which would make the film partially animation and partially live action. K. S. Ravikumar then developed a story for fifteen days with his team assistants and after being impressed by the script, Rajinikanth felt that Ravikumar's story should be an entirely separate film. It was also reported that K. S. Ravikumar was signed up as co-director to direct "non-animated" scenes of the film, in which Rajinikanth would pair up with Trisha Krishnan. The reports were later falsified as several websites on 28 January 2011, claimed that Rana was a separate project, jointly produced by Eros International and Soundarya's Ocher Picture Productions.
